Northfleet station caters to travelers with a range of facilities carefully tailored to assist in ticket purchasing and support services. The ticket office operates during the weekday mornings from 06:10 to 10:10, complementing this with user-friendly ticket machines available for use at any time. You can also collect tickets bought online with ease, as the machines are conveniently located in the station forecourt.
For those needing special assistance, Northfleet provides step-free access to certain areas of the station, though travelers should be aware that platform interchange without steps is not possible. Access to platform 2 is designed for comfort while boarding services away from London, but platform 1, which caters towards London, involves stair access only.

Uckfield station ensures convenience with its ticket office operating on weekdays and Saturdays, while accessible ticket machines are always ready to help. For those of you intending to collect tickets purchased online, rest assured there's a collection machine stationed here for that very purpose.
Despite the quaint setting, the station is well-equipped with essential amenities like an induction loop and help points. Information can be obtained from screens or by announcements – a boon for keeping up with track changes and departures.
While there are no waiting rooms, the station doesn't leave you stranded: seating areas are available for those moments when you need to gather your thoughts or catch up on reading. To ensure security, the station and bicycle storage area are monitored by CCTV.
Uckfield station prides itself on step-free access across the platforms, making it a user-friendly environment for all travelers. Though there aren't accessible sundecked car park options, assistance points and ramps do compensate, simplifying boardings and alightings for passengers with limited mobility. You can even pre-book assistance for added peace of mind.
